Crush syndrome refers to a clinical syndrome characterized by limb swelling, necrosis, hyperkalemia, myoglobinuria, and acute kidney injury caused by prolonged compression of the muscle-rich parts of the limbs or trunk.
The core link of crush syndrome is rhabdomyolysis, which causes the leakage of muscle cell contents into extracellular fluid and blood circulation, resulting in a series of complications such as effective circulating blood volume reduction, electrolyte imbalance, acute renal failure, and multi-organ insufficiency.
